Появились компоненты для создания формы и всех визуальных контролов произвольного вида, какой только Вам подскажет фантазия.
Вот простой пример создания формы.
Этот топик читают: Гость
Главный модератор
Ответов: 2999
Рейтинг: 396
|
|||
карма: 6 |
| ||
Голосовали: | filyaxxxcom, afandi, Konst, EcsTasY, LainX |
Ответов: 542
Рейтинг: 12
|
|||
Интересно +1.
А вот к компонентам лучще подобрать более понятные иконки, и в каком разделе палитри будут эти компоненты? |
|||
карма: 0 |
|
Разработчик
Ответов: 26163
Рейтинг: 2127
|
|||
afandi писал(а): и в каком разделе палитри будут эти компоненты?Пока, в стадии тестирования. |
|||
карма: 22 |
|
Ответов: 5227
Рейтинг: 587
|
|||
А скрин в студию можно
|
|||
карма: 4 |
|
Администрация
Ответов: 15295
Рейтинг: 1519
|
|||
[img=Работа с регионами на форме align=left]http://dev.hiasm.com/xf/attach/files/regions.png[/img]
на рисунке схема HiAsm и соответсвующая ей результирующая форма после запуска программы |
|||
карма: 27 |
| ||
файлы: 1 | regions.png [7.1KB] [456] |
Ответов: 876
Рейтинг: 101
|
|||
карма: 1 |
| ||
файлы: 1 | code_11739.txt [1KB] [557] |
Ответов: 5446
Рейтинг: 323
|
|||
flud, а ты размер результирующего exe сравни. В твоём варианте пристёгивается лишнаяя картинка, а в варианте Дилмы - ничего.
|
|||
карма: 1 |
|
Администрация
Ответов: 15295
Рейтинг: 1519
|
|||
принципиально - ни в чем, технически - в размере файла. Никто и не говорил, что она должна быть.
|
|||
карма: 27 |
|
Ответов: 542
Рейтинг: 12
|
|||
flud писал(а): и в чем разница от подобной схемы Наверное в том что в первом случае можно, в процессе работы программы можно динамически менять форму окна. А во втором случае нужно подготавливать картинку заранее |
|||
карма: 0 |
|
Администрация
Ответов: 15295
Рейтинг: 1519
|
|||
в примере ниже динамическая полоска двигается вдоль формы, оставляя в ней вертикальную щель
code_11743.txt |
|||
карма: 27 |
| ||
файлы: 1 | code_11743.txt [1.7KB] [552] |
Разработчик
Ответов: 26163
Рейтинг: 2127
|
|||
Народ, а сами-то компоненты где плавают, че-то я в упор в аттачах не вижу ихний архив
|
|||
карма: 22 |
|
Администрация
Ответов: 15295
Рейтинг: 1519
|
|||
nesco, неужели с инетом совсем все так плохо Коммит был сделан еще 42 часа назад
http://code.google.com/p/hiasm/source/detail?r=1560 |
|||
карма: 27 |
|
Главный модератор
Ответов: 2999
Рейтинг: 396
|
|||
Dilma, напрашивается вынос из hiMainFrom.pas функции создания региона по файлу.
|
|||
карма: 6 |
|
Администрация
Ответов: 15295
Рейтинг: 1519
|
|||
это конечно следовало бы с самого начала сделать, но сейчас из-за совместимости со старыми проектами такое будет сложно реализовать...
|
|||
карма: 27 |
|
Главный модератор
Ответов: 2999
Рейтинг: 396
|
|||
Компонент RGN_file будет работать не только с главной формой, как метод doPicture из компонента MainForm, но с любым контролом, имеющим handle.
Можно воспользоваться забугорным опытом: - делается новый компонент RGN_file - объявляется о прекращении поддержки метода doPicture компонента MainForm - выпускается версия среды в которой работают обе возможности создания вида формы по файлу - объявляется об удалении метода doPicture из компонента MainForm и предлагается схема его замены внешним компонентом - выпускается версия среды в которой нет метода doPicture из компонента MainForm |
|||
карма: 6 |
|